What is an assistant unique LPN?

An Assistant Unique LPN is a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N) who provides specialized nursing care under the supervision of registered nurses or physicians, often in unique or non-traditional healthcare settings. Their duties typically include monitoring patient health, administering basic nursing care, and assisting with daily living activities. The 'unique' aspect may refer to working with specific populations or in specialized medical environments. Assistant Unique LPNs play a vital role in ensuring quality patient care and supporting the broader healthcare team.

What are some common challenges that assistant unique LPNs face when supporting diverse patient populations?

Assistant Unique LPNs often encounter the challenge of adapting communication and care approaches to suit patients from various backgrounds and with different medical needs. They must remain flexible and empathetic, especially when handling language barriers or cultural differences. Collaborating closely with RNs, physicians, and interdisciplinary teams is crucial to ensure coordinated care. Additionally, managing a high patient load while maintaining documentation accuracy can be demanding, but effective time management and teamwork help overcome these obstacles.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an assistant unique LPN,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Assistant LPN, you need a practical nursing diploma, LPN licensure, and foundational skills in patient care, medication administration, and basic clinical procedures. Familiarity with electronic health record (EHR) systems, standard medical equipment, and infection control protocols is typically required. Compassion, reliability, and strong teamwork skills help you provide effective care and build positive relationships with patients and colleagues. These competencies are crucial for ensuring patient safety, delivering quality care, and supporting overall healthcare team efficiency.

What is the difference between Assistant Unique Lpn vs Certified Nursing Assistant (CNA)?

AspectAssistant Unique LpnCertified Nursing Assistant (CNA)
CredentialsLicensed Practical Nurse (LPN) licenseCertified Nursing Assistant (CNA) certification
Work EnvironmentHospitals, clinics, long-term care facilitiesSkilled nursing facilities, hospitals, home health
Job ResponsibilitiesAdminister medications, basic patient care, assist with proceduresBasic patient care, bathing, feeding, vital signs
Industry UsageHealthcare, nursingHealthcare, patient support

The Assistant Unique Lpn and CNA roles both provide vital patient care but differ mainly in credentials and responsibilities. The LPN has a licensed practical nurse license and performs more advanced tasks, while CNAs focus on basic patient support. Both roles are essential in healthcare settings, with LPNs often working alongside RNs and physicians, and CNAs providing foundational care.
